Club Comanche Hotel Saint Croix
Search & compare prices for Club Comanche Hotel Saint Croix in all hotel booking websites.
Club Comanche Hotel Saint Croix Address: 1 Strand Street, Christiansted, Saint Croix, Virgin Islands, U.S.
Minimum price found for Club Comanche Hotel Saint Croix was: 216 USD
Click here to get more information, photos & guest ratings for Club Comanche Hotel Saint Croix